The Ernie Els Big Easy Red 2023 is a polished, Cabernet Sauvignon-led blend from the slopes of the Helderberg, offering a balanced expression of Stellenbosch fruit with a smooth, approachable style. Inspired by Ernie Els’ nickname, this wine combines structure with an easy-drinking appeal.

In the glass, it shows a ruby core with a translucent rim, opening with aromas of black and red cherry, layered with notes of cinnamon, all-spice, and tobacco leaf. The Cabernet Sauvignon provides structure, while Shiraz adds a lift of spice and aromatic freshness. Subtle contributions from Cabernet Franc, Petit Verdot, and Malbec bring added depth, with hints of cacao, red pepper, and tomato leaf. On the palate, the wine is medium-bodied and harmonious, with silky tannins and fresh acidity supporting a core of layered fruit. The finish is smooth, balanced, and quietly complex.

A versatile, food-friendly red that pairs effortlessly with grilled meats, burgers, pasta, and everyday dining.
The grapes were sourced from selected vineyard parcels on the Helderberg Mountain, where altitude (around 250m) and proximity to the Atlantic Ocean extend the ripening period and enhance phenolic development. Each varietal component was vinified separately, allowing for careful management of extraction and balance.

Following fermentation, the wine was matured in oak barrels to integrate tannins and build complexity while maintaining the wine’s approachable style. The final blend was assembled to achieve balance, texture, and drinkability, staying true to the Big Easy philosophy.

As one of South Africa's leading ambassadors and one of the most recognizable faces in the world of sport, it is befitting that Ernie chose Stellenbosch to produce his wines. In 1999 the concept of Ernie Els Wines was born and with the help of award-winning winemaker Louis Strydom, they produced the maiden, 2000 vintage of Ernie Els - a classic Bordeaux blend.

The marketing synergy between the wine and Ernie's classic golf swing were apparent. The intention from the outset was to focus on delivering a quality product that could hold its own in the company of the world's finest wines.

Naturally the plan was to start on a small scale, ensuring the packaging and presentation, marketing and distribution, were of a standard that was in-line with their vision for a premium product.
